hebrew #7675 - שֶׁבֶת shebeth (seat)


Original Word:שֶׁבֶת
Transliteration: shebeth
Definition:seat, dwelling, place
Part of Speech:Noun Feminine
Phonetic Spelling:(sheh'-beth)

Strong's Exhaustive Concordance

place, seat

Infinitive of yashab; properly, session; but used also concretely, an abode or locality -- place, seat. Compare Yosheb bash-Shebeth.

Brown-Driver-Briggs

I. שֶׁ֫בֶתnoun feminineseat, dwelling, place (properly Infinitive Qal from ישׁב) — מְקוֺם הַשָּׁ֑בֶת1 Kings 10:19 2Chronicles 9:18 the place of the seat; שֶׁבֶת חָמָסAmos 6:3a seat (throne, or enthronement) of violence; לְשֶׁבֶת עָ֑רNumbers 21:15toward the dwelling (i.e. place, location) of 'Âr; יִ˜שּׂרְסּוּ בַשָּׁ֑בֶת2 Samuel 23:7they are burned in the (same) place,, i.e on the spot, but strike out ׳שׁ We Dr Bu; שִׁבְתּוֺ Obadiah 3 his (thy) dwelling-place — II. שֶׁבֶת see below שׁבת.
